What is Zamzam Water?
Zamzam water originates from the sacred well in Makkah, which sprang miraculously for Hajar and her infant son, Prophet Ismail (peace be upon them). Since that time, it has remained a symbol of divine mercy, sustenance, and barakah. The Prophet ﷺ said: “Zamzam water is for whatever it is drunk for.” (Sunan Ibn Majah, 3062) This Hadith highlights its unique quality: any sincere supplication made while drinking Zamzam is more likely to be accepted.

The Dua for Drinking Zamzam Water in Arabic
The traditional supplication to recite while drinking Zamzam water is:
اللّهُمّ إني أسألك علماً نافعاً، ورزقاً طيباً، وعملاً متقبلاً
Transliteration:
Allahumma inni as’aluka ‘ilman nafi’an, wa rizqan tayyiban, wa ‘amalan mutaqabbalan.
This dua beautifully encompasses a heartfelt prayer for beneficial knowledge, pure provision, and accepted deeds, which aligns perfectly with the purpose of drinking Zamzam water.
The Dua for Drinking Zamzam Water in English
In English, the meaning of the dua is:
“O Allah, I ask You for beneficial knowledge, good and pure sustenance, and deeds that are accepted.”Refrence: Sunan Ibn Majah Hadith Number: 925

When and How to Recite the Dua
To ensure maximum reward, follow these steps:
Before Drinking: Hold the cup with your right hand, focus on your intention, and recite the dua clearly.
During Drinking: Take small sips, maintain presence of heart, and reflect on the blessings of Allah.
After Drinking: You may make personal duas for yourself, your family, or others.
